#192: (WIP: Needs Work) Replace PythonDataflowTask With BeamDataflowJobTask#199
#192: (WIP: Needs Work) Replace PythonDataflowTask With BeamDataflowJobTask#199
Conversation
Codecov Report
@@ Coverage Diff @@
## master #199 +/- ##
=========================================
- Coverage 89.11% 87.91% -1.2%
=========================================
Files 12 11 -1
Lines 744 596 -148
=========================================
- Hits 663 524 -139
+ Misses 81 72 -9
Continue to review full report at Codecov.
|
brianmartin
left a comment
There was a problem hiding this comment.
Should we have a new version minimum for luigi?
Line 26 in 8e807b9
spotify_tensorflow/luigi/tfx_task.py
Outdated
| ] | ||
|
|
||
| def dataflow_executable(self): | ||
| """ Must be overwritten from the BeamDataflowTaski """ |
There was a problem hiding this comment.
Yup, good catch
PR is still WIP cause the new beam task is refactored a bunch, trying to fix tests
|
There is still work to be done on this ticket. Documenting some discussions on how to proceed: Switching to The most pertinent point is that now there is a class called There are, generally, 2 approaches that can be taken here:
|
Removes
PythonDataflowTaskand related files/tests to replace it with the luigi.contribBeamDataflowJobTask